Study on Manufacturing Technology of Ag-8.5Au-3.5Pd Fine Alloy Wire
The performance of Ag-8.5Au-3.5Pd alloy wire after cold deformation and annealing were analyzed by SEM (scanning electron microscope), strength tester and resistivity tester.
